Overview

Poly-N-acetylglucosamine polysaccharide (PNAG) is a structurally conserved exopolysaccharide critical to biofilm architecture across numerous pathogenic bacteria. Its unique chemical features enable strong adhesive properties essential for persistent infections on biotic and abiotic surfaces. Due to its ubiquity among pathogens and immunogenic potential, it remains an important focus for anti-biofilm therapeutic strategies including vaccines targeting device-related infections.
